The Sloop Island Canal Boat is a standard canal boat from the last generation of canal boats on Lake Champlain. The Champlain Canal locks expanded over time, and with them the size of canal boats. At 97 feet …

Lake Champlain is the eighth largest naturally occurring body of fresh water in the continental United States. Champlain covers 435 square miles of surface water and contains more than 70 islands. The lake is 120 miles long with nearly 600 miles of shoreline and lies in a valley flanked by Vermont's Green Mountains to the ...

What was once the Royal Savage Yacht Club will now be called the Diamond Island Yacht Club. “We ...The Diamond Island Stone Boat Courtesy of the Lake Champlain Maritime Museum. The Diamond Island Stone Boat was one of hundreds of wooden canal boats that transported cargo throughout the lake and Champlain Canal. The name of this boat, who owned her, and when she navigated the lake have not yet been determined.Knight Point on North Hero Island opened as a state park in 1978, but its history goes back much further. H. McAllister (1942). Because of its depth, the site was one of the subjects of ROV documentation during the 1997 season. The vessel is in very good condition, and red and white paint is still clearly visible on the hull. The tug has settled heavily into the bottom of the lake, and mud covers a ...April 8 , 1:00 pm - 4:30 pm. Free. Want to watch the solar eclipse away from busy roads and buildings?
